What Drives Price
Model, material quality, and repair scope strongly affect the price. Primary drivers include the iPad model (standard vs Pro), digitizer type (true touch panel vs laminated assembly), and whether the LCD or backlight requires replacement. Additional costs appear with extra adhesives, brackets, or waterproof seals. A larger device or higher-tier screen generally commands higher labor and parts costs.
Cost Drivers
Two niche-specific thresholds influence quotes: first, device generation and screen complexity; second, the need to replace the LCD and/or touchscreen controller. For example, Pro models often require higher-cost assemblies and precise calibration, while older standard models may use more affordable parts. Labor time typically scales with disassembly difficulty and the need for sensor alignment checks.

Regional Price Differences
Prices vary by region due to labor markets and shop density. In urban markets, labor tends to be higher, while suburban shops may offer lower hourly rates. Rural areas can be cheaper for labor but might incur higher parts shipping. Typical regional deltas are ±10-20% from national averages, with the highest costs usually in coastal cities and the lowest in inland regions.
Labor, Hours & Rates
Labor hours for digitizer replacement typically range from 1.5 to 3 hours for standard models, and 2.5 to 4 hours for Pro models with more complex assemblies. Real-World Pricing Examples
Three scenario snapshots illustrate typical outcomes.
Basic
Model: Standard iPad, no LCD replacement, third-party digitizer. Specs: 1.5 hours labor, $60/hour, parts $40. Total around $150.
Mid-Range
Model: iPad Air or standard iPad with LCD intact. Specs: 2 hours labor, parts $75, adhesives $15, tax $12. Total around $210.
Premium
Model: iPad Pro with laminated display and new LCD. Specs: 3 hours labor, parts $120, tools $20, warranty add-on $30. Total around $360.
